Why people still pay
People still pay for Quickbase because teams pay when a flexible database becomes a shared operational system with integrations and years of accumulated business logic. The recurring cost buys schema changes, formulas, permissions, imports, attachments, views, APIs, concurrency, backups, and migrations, not just the visible interface.
Years of history, configuration, and habits make migration costly.
Permissions, presence, and shared workflows are difficult to simplify.
Connectors, OAuth flows, and vendor API changes require constant upkeep.

Implementation brief
Build a closest honest personal substitute for Quickbase in an empty repository.
Use Next.js 15, TypeScript, PostgreSQL, Drizzle ORM, and Docker Compose; do not offer alternative stacks.
The core loop is: model structured records in a constrained operational database for one small team, provide form, grid, kanban, and filtered views, and expose a documented API.
Make the first run work locally with one documented command.
Store all user data locally by default and make export straightforward.
Put secrets in .env, ship .env.example, and never commit credentials.
Create workspaces, bases, tables, fields, records, attachments, relations, and saved views.
Support text, number, currency, date, boolean, select, formula-lite, and relation field types.
Build grid, form, kanban, and record-detail views from one canonical schema.
Add role-based permissions, optimistic concurrency checks, audit history, and trash restore.
Provide CSV import or export and a token-authenticated REST API generated from the schema.
Ship migrations, seed data, backups, health checks, and a schema export format.
Include clear empty, loading, success, and recoverable error states.
Add input validation, safe filenames, and graceful handling of unavailable APIs.
Write focused tests for the core transformation and one end-to-end happy path.
Create a README with setup, architecture, permissions, data location, and backup steps.
Do not add accounts, billing, telemetry, analytics, or a hosted control plane.
Do not claim to reproduce proprietary data, network liquidity, regulated access, or frontier infrastructure.
Deliberately leave out full spreadsheet formula compatibility.
Deliberately leave out hundreds of automations and integrations.
Deliberately leave out large-enterprise governance and vendor-managed scale.
Finish by running the tests and listing the exact commands used.
